Responsibilities

Prepare plot plans, equipment location drawings, flow diagrams, Process and Instrumentation Diagrams (P&IDs) and other related engineering/design drawings

Create CAD drawings (Isometrics and Piping Plans) from designer layouts or sketches

Incorporate/Backdraft comments on drawings based on designer/checker comments

Translate design sketches, layouts, and notes into construction drawings

Ability to add details to piping documents based on P&IDs including understanding construction and process driven notes.

Create detailed design drawings with detailed bill of materials

Cut plans/sections and support annotation of complex 2D deliverables

Prepare detailed tie in lists with field notes and P&IDs and minimal direction

Review changes and be able to provide input to Leads/Supervisors

Ability to do detailed valve take offs from P&IDs
